Section 17-17-34 - Paying, etc., or accepting payment for vote.

Universal Citation: AL Code § 17-17-34 (2019)
Section 17-17-34Paying, etc., or accepting payment for vote.

It shall be unlawful for any person to pay or offer to pay, or for any person to accept such payment, either to vote or withhold his or her vote, or to vote for or against any candidate. Any person who violates this section shall be guilty, upon conviction, of a Class C misdemeanor.

(Act 2006-570, p. 1331, §88.)
